Microsoft Surface laptop-7 was released on June 18, 2024 and support is scheduled to end on June 18, 2030 — a planned supported lifespan of 6 years, in line with the 6 years median for Microsoft Surface releases.

What does Microsoft Surface Surface Laptop (7th generation) end of life mean?
When Microsoft Surface Surface Laptop (7th generation) reaches end of life, the maintainers stop issuing security patches for this version. CVEs discovered after the EOL date are publicly disclosed on the National Vulnerability Database with no patch available. Exploit code frequently appears on GitHub within days of disclosure.
The CVE blind spot: Most vulnerability scanners check for known CVEs but do not flag the ongoing accumulation of unpatched vulnerabilities in EOL software versions. Running Microsoft Surface Surface Laptop (7th generation) past its EOL date creates a permanently growing attack surface that standard security tooling will not surface.
